Rosberg: High hopes despite qualifying disappointment

Nico Rosberg has high hopes for the 44-lap Belgian Grand Prix, despite the disappointment of being once again out-qualified by team-mate Lewis Hamilton. The Briton proved too quick around the Spa-Francorchamps circuit, resulting in a gap of just under half a second between the duo.
